Compute the positive square root of the discriminant of the parabola f(x) = -6x*2 + (18)x + (2) to one place of decimal.
:
The discriminant: b^2 - 4ac
This equation: a=-6; b=18; c=2
d = 18^2 - 4*-6*2
d = 324 + 48
d = 372
the positive square root:
sqrt%28372%29 ~ 19.3
